Sitecode: 47121
what a beautiful campsite and what a beautiful location, you can walk straight onto the Veluwe! large dog walking area opposite the campsite, really big! 4 stars because there was no sun on our spot, it was the last summer week in September. Sanitary facilities fine and nice owners.
Sitecode: 86884
what a fantastic campsite! we stayed here, with a big dog, for 5 days with pleasure. the atmosphere is friendly, you don't pay for showering for example, there is ice cream for sale in a small freezer and you pay with qr code and so on. beautiful sanitary facilities, the field was almost full and yet we had enough with 3 toilets. lots of play opportunities for big and small children and the campsite is located in a great nature reserve! we would love to come back!
Sitecode: 3493
what a nice spot, within walking distance of Workum. yes, you drive to the campsite through a bit of industry, but you don't notice it once you are standing. nice places to explore, the owner is happy to think along with you. Excellent sanitary facilities! Nice shop with homemade food and cold special beers.
